So today we left the prismo hotel in Cuzco around 8am and started heading for our Amazon lodge with g adventures.
We caught our flight no problem and were the transported by safari bus with luggage on the roof to g adventures office where we re packed a duffle and left our large luggage. From there with our lightened load we got back on the safari bus and went to the river boat launch. It was probably 30 km away and tookabout an hour to reach it. Along the way we saw papaya trees and weaver bird nests amongst other things.
We then hopped on the river boat. It was two seats wide and an aisle in the middle. We were given a packed lunch of rice French fries, fried chicken and vegetables. And a couple of those awesome little finger bananas.
Along the way Leo our new guide, pointed out and we stopped the boat to look and capaberras (the largest rodents in the world, ) monkeys, caimans, monkeys, macas, and other things. We got really close to the capaberras and caimans. It was pretty cool. We also saw another river boat sunk and participate in the effort to rescue the products they were transporting. Mainly, wild tomatoes and plantains. One of the guys was jumping in and out of the water pulling stuff out.
After all that it took more then 2 hours to reach the lodge. We got a welcome drink. And got a briefing on jungle safety and an over view of where things are in the lodge and we were sent on our way.
We are to meet back at the dinning room to do a briefing for our night walk at 630. After the briefing we will have supper then do the night walk.
The rooms are half a bungalow but no electricity but they do have water and a candle so it isn't all bad. The sounds of the wild are great.
After we broke and dropped our stuff in the bungalow Lori hung out in the bungalow and I went for a nature walk down to the swimmers big hole with the English girls.
